Iraq: construction work starts on the French Medical Center in Sinjar
After a year and a half of preparatory work, we signed a general construction contract with a local company in October 2021, leading to the start of work on the hospital in December 2021. On this date, we were able to organize the first on-site training session for young doctors from the area, in the presence of two French experts (a surgeon and an anesthetist).
Installed on land made available by the Iraqi Ministry of Health, this hospital will strengthen the healthcare offer in Sinjar and the Nineveh Plain. Beginning in 2019 and supported by the Ministry of Europe and Foreign Affairs’ Crisis and Support Center and the European Union’s Madad Fund, this project reinforces the work of 2018 co-Nobel Peace Prize winner Nadia Murad and her Foundation, Nadia’s Initiative. The year 2021 saw the completion of the entire execution design, the tendering with Iraqi companies and the signing of construction and supervision contracts.

Beforehand, La Chaîne de l’Espoir worked with contractors to ensure safe access to the site from the main road. We built a long gutter to direct water run-off during the rainy season, and an upper platform.
